#bash #ubuntu #terminator
#bash #ubuntu #терминатор
Вопрос:
Описание проблемы:
Я пытаюсь использовать terminator в скрипте bash, но я продолжаю получать сообщение об ошибке, указывающее, что такого файла или каталога нет : ~/.config/terminator/config
. и это не позволяет терминалам появляться на экране. Однако, когда я запускаю terminator на своем терминале, появляется окно. Итак, у меня определенно установлен terminator, я просто не знаю, где находится terminator / config.
Вопросы и краткое изложение проблемы:
- Как мне проверить, существует ли terminator / config в моей системе?
- Где я могу его найти, поскольку его нет
~/.config
? - Почему это должно происходить?
Решения, которые я знаю, не работают, и дополнительная информация
- Удаление и переустановка. Я сделал это до того, как пришел на этот сайт, чтобы спросить.
- Это команды, которые я использовал для его установки в первый раз:
- sudo add-apt-repository ppa: gnome-terminator
- sudo apt-получить обновление
- sudo apt-get установить терминатор
- Я не думаю, что я был в домашнем каталоге, когда устанавливал terminator, если это имеет значение.
Ответ №1:
Как мне проверить, существует ли terminator / config в моей системе?
Либо найдите файл с помощью ‘locate’:
$ sudo apt install locate -y
$ sudo updatedb # this is to update the file database
$ locate config
Или, что еще лучше, используйте stat:
$ stat ~/.config/terminator/config
Где я могу его найти, поскольку его нет в ~/.config ?
Если файл не существует, вы, конечно, не сможете его найти.
Возможно, создайте файл самостоятельно.
$ mkdir -p ~/.config/terminator/
$ touch ~/.config/terminator/config
Почему это должно происходить?
Система выдает сообщение об ошибке. Потому что он ожидает, что там будет file, которого нет. Пожалуйста, прочитайте документацию.